    package middleware
    
    // Code generated by gowrap. DO NOT EDIT.
    // template: ../../../assets/templates/middleware/access_log
    // gowrap: http://github.com/hexdigest/gowrap
    
    //go:generate gowrap gen -p git.perx.ru/perxis/perxis-go/pkg/roles -i Roles -t ../../../assets/templates/middleware/access_log -o logging_middleware.go -l ""
    
    import (
    	"context"
    	"fmt"
    	"time"
    
    	"git.perx.ru/perxis/perxis-go/pkg/auth"
    	"git.perx.ru/perxis/perxis-go/pkg/roles"
    	"go.uber.org/zap"
    	"go.uber.org/zap/zapcore"
    )
    
    // loggingMiddleware implements roles.Roles that is instrumented with logging
    type loggingMiddleware struct {
    	logger *zap.Logger
    	next   roles.Roles
    }
    
    // LoggingMiddleware instruments an implementation of the roles.Roles with simple logging
    func LoggingMiddleware(logger *zap.Logger) Middleware {
    	return func(next roles.Roles) roles.Roles {
    		return &loggingMiddleware{
    			next:   next,
    			logger: logger,
    		}
    	}
    }
    
    func (m *loggingMiddleware) Create(ctx context.Context, role *roles.Role) (created *roles.Role, err error) {
    	begin := time.Now()
    	var fields []zapcore.Field
    	for k, v := range map[string]interface{}{
    		"ctx":  ctx,
    		"role": role} {
    		if k == "ctx" {
    			fields = append(fields, zap.String("principal", fmt.Sprint(auth.GetPrincipal(ctx))))
    			continue
    		}
    		fields = append(fields, zap.Reflect(k, v))
    	}
    
    	m.logger.Debug("Create.Request", fields...)
    
    	created, err = m.next.Create(ctx, role)
    
    	fields = []zapcore.Field{
    		zap.Duration("time", time.Since(begin)),
    	}
    
    	for k, v := range map[string]interface{}{
    		"created": created,
    		"err":     err} {
    		if k == "err" {
    			err, _ := v.(error)
    			fields = append(fields, zap.Error(err))
    			continue
    		}
    		fields = append(fields, zap.Reflect(k, v))
    	}
    
    	m.logger.Debug("Create.Response", fields...)
    
    	return created, err
    }
